Runbook — Keyturner rotation utility

Before a release cut, run Keyturner in dry-run mode and confirm zero pending rotations. If rotations are queued, execute them, wait for the vault sync flag, then rerun dry-run. Never cut a release while a rotation is mid-flight; the staging mirror will desync. After a clean pass, capture the utility's output summary and attach it to the release checklist. Record the attested run under the token printed below.

session token of taduf-tahog = htk4_91a1

Subject: Key rotation for the Murmurcast feed validator

Hello future maintainers,

As part of our quarterly security cycle, we have rotated the credential the Murmurcast feed validator uses to reach the internal fetch service, Wirebird. The old key will stop working at the end of the month, so any long-lived workers must be restarted after updating their configuration. Rotation steps and rollback notes are documented in the operations wiki. For convenience during the migration window, the new key is included below.

gateway credential: zpat3_i6x

## Pooling notes for Wednesday's sync

Quick refresher before we debate pool sizes again: Burrowbase caps us at 200 connections total, and every service sharing that budget is why staging keeps falling over. PgBouncer sits in front now, so point your service at it, not the database. Your local env needs the pooler credential — add this line first:

env line for fafof-fahag: LEDGER_TOKEN5=f8790

# Q3 Cash-Flow Forecast (Managers Only)

For sales leads at Torvane Instruments: operating cash inflow is projected at a modest surplus, contingent on collections from the Pellbrook and Ashmere accounts landing before quarter close. Capital outlays for the Skylar bench upgrade are deferred. Please align deal timing with these constraints; the underlying plan appears directly below.

board note of fahag-tajop: The eastern region missed its Julix quota by 44.0 percent last quarter. Ralionax Holdings plans to lower the Druath list price by 61.8 percent in March. The board signed off on a budget of $295.0 million for Project Gilath. The renewal with Ruswynix Systems closes at $274.5 million a year, 17.0 percent above the last contract.